This refers to the tiny dungeon in which British prisoners of war were held in June 1756 after the fall of Fort William, Calcutta, where (allegedly) the vast majority perished from suffocation or heat exhaustion because so many people were crammed into such a small space. According to a post on boards.ie, this can sometimes be abbreviated to its black in here to describe a crowded space. Irish has the expression dubh le daoine, and a literal translation of that black with people is used in Irish English to describe a crowded space. The TV has been used a lot today.
